WebPediatric Diarrhea Share: Key Points About Diarrhea in Children Diarrhea is loose, watery bowel movements (stool). Your child may also have to go to the bathroom more often. He may or may not … signs food poisoning chickenWebDec 30, 2024 · Diaper rashes are very common in babies. Often caused by not cleaning stool off the skin soon enough. Stool is a strong irritant to the skin. Here's some care advice that should help. Change More Often: Change diapers more often to prevent skin contact with stool.
